The song is a dramatic ballad of regret and self-reproach. In the lyrics, the narrator laments his own infidelity and how he mistreated a partner who was "like an angel". He expresses a wish that she had loved him less or even "blown him up with a bomb" so he wouldn't have to live with the guilt of destroying such a pure love.
"" (English: "Why Didn't You Love Me Less") is a popular Turbo-folk track by Bosnian-born Serbian singer Mile Kitić , officially released as a music video on August 14, 2015 .
